The CAS Registry Mumber 126771-41-3 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,2,6,7,7 and 1 respectively; the second part has 2 digits, 4 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 126771-41:
(8*1)+(7*2)+(6*6)+(5*7)+(4*7)+(3*1)+(2*4)+(1*1)=133
133 % 10 = 3
So 126771-41-3 is a valid CAS Registry Number.
